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
324 927783554 269925 98
06 33158
06 33158
57 6919566 6602304
All about undefined
Interested in learning more?
06 33158
57 6919566 6602304
See more
882807771 810 0917605131
69 15351659 39 60508 293547584
See more
537583618 4308263 810907509
9799 73 070453 96
See more